Components - Details

Human Resources | Remuneration | Base Components | Components | Details tab

Summary

The Components entity records:

  • The base components that make up an employee’s remuneration package.
  • Whether these components can be cashed up i.e. rather than the employee receiving the cash, the company pays for the benefit. For example medical insurance.

Fields
Type:

This field classifies the type of Component created. Select from

  • Base Salary

    Where the Component is a Salary item.

  • Cash

    Where the component is a cash item, such as an allowance, of a dollar value. A cash component is added to the Base Salary.

  • Non-Cash

    Where the component is a benefit paid for by the employer such as Medical Insurance premiums where no extra cash is paid to the employee.

  • On-Cost

    Where the component primarily benefits the employer, for example Training.

FBT:

This field determines if there is a Fringe Benefit Tax (FBT) obligation associated with this Component. Select Yes if Fringe Benefit tax applies to a Component.

Taxation Requirements

Generally Non-Cash Components are subject to FBT and Cash Components are not.
